About the role

We are seeking an Associate Corporate Counsel to join our team. The ideal candidate will advise on drafting and negotiating a broad range of commercial agreements with vendors, serving as a trusted legal advisor to Supply Chain, Information Technology, and other functions and business units.

Responsibilities

  • Partner closely with Supply Chain, Procurement, Information Technology, and business units to support global sourcing, manufacturing, and logistics
  • Draft, review, negotiate, and advise on a wide variety of agreements, including master supply agreements, SaaS agreements, consulting and professional services agreements, data privacy agreements and non-disclosure agreements
  • Build strong relationships with internal stakeholders and provide proactive, business-oriented advice to the business
  • Support negotiation strategy and contract standardization initiatives, including development and maintenance of policies, processes, templates and playbooks
  • Aid in resolving commercial disputes and contract interpretation questions
  • Provide support for M&A activities and other strategic transactions

Requirements

You must be within 2 hours driving distance from our offices in one of these locations (eastern and central time zones): Andover, MA (preferred), Rochester, NY, Rock Hill, SC, Broomfield, CO. Must have a JD degree from an ABA-accredited law school and be admitted in good standing to practice law in at least one state in the U.S. 5+ years of related legal experience required. Relevant contract management, supply chain experience, as well as internships or clerkships may be considered toward some of this requirement. In-house legal department preferred. Must have demonstrated experience drafting and negotiating complex commercial agreements, particularly SaaS and other IT contracts. Experience with technology R&D and manufacturing companies preferred. Experience with data privacy laws preferred. Ability to provide clear, pragmatic advice in a business-focused environment. Strong interpersonal and excellent written and verbal communication skills and ability to collaborate effectively across functions. Comfortable balancing legal risk with commercial objectives. Highly organized, detail-oriented, responsive and able to work independently. Proficient in Microsoft Office product suite, including Word, Excel and PowerPoint.
